Transaction 429382789a2caca95cb15a7b56988c50e0908c9493f4237cf7f09573538d8f69

block
34a8c4194ba1ad816338d0f1d75b841e57e8f602fe86f67d1743d1ddfd3ab31f

1 Input

24 Outputs